Argentina - Import of Hot-Rolled Iron or Non-Alloy Steel in Coils, of a Width of 600 mm or More, Thickness of 3-4.75 mm and Minimum Yield Point Not Exceeding 355 Mpa
Since 2014, Argentina Import of Hot-Rolled Iron or Non-Alloy Steel in Coils, of a Width of 600 mm or More, Thickness of 3-4.75 mm and Minimum Yield Point Not Exceeding 355 Mpa jumped by 71.6% year on year. At $16,011,255.88 in 2019, the country was ranked number 46 comparing other countries in Import of Hot-Rolled Iron or Non-Alloy Steel in Coils, of a Width of 600 mm or More, Thickness of 3-4.75 mm and Minimum Yield Point Not Exceeding 355 Mpa. Argentina is overtaken by Lebanon, which was ranked number 45 with $16,927,927.48 and is followed by Serbia at $15,403,470.11. Italy ranked the highest with $1,023,836,681.76 in 2019, -2.9% versus 2018. China, Thailand and Viet Nam resp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Azerbaijan recorded the best 5 years average growth at +158.9% per year, while Barbados recorded the worst performance at -83.5% per year.
